Thanks to everyone else too who has ordered one, it's nice to see so much interest! I've been getting some good questions too. There are certain ones that I keep seeing, so I've put together a little FAQ to hopefully address the most common ones. I've copied it from the EZ Glider Facebook page:

FAQ:
Q: Aren't you just overcharging for an off-the shelf tube?
A: No. I started with off-the shelf tubes, but nothing worked perfectly. Available tubes are the right size but too floppy, or the right stiffness but too large. After some research and development, I determined the right combination of material and dimensions, and custom extruded the tubing just for this product.

Q: Why do you offer motor oil? Don't you know that's bad for cables?
A: My manufacturer (Yamaha) recommends motor oil for the cables, so I started there for the first generation product. It is proven to work, and won't void my warranty. I am developing a dry type of lubricant, but again nothing off the shelf is perfect, so I'm formulating my own. I hope to offer this by Spring 2011.

Q: Can the syringes be refilled?
A: I can't guarantee they can be refilled. Over several months, the plunger swells with oil, preventing it from being drawn back to suck up oil. This doesn't affect the injection of oil, but the plunger can't be drawn backwards at some point. I do sell refill kits for a lower price that include three pre-filled syringes with no tube

Q: Do you ship internationally? What about customs?
A: I have shipped to UK, France, Singapore, Australia, and Canada with no problem. I do ship internationally, but higher postage rates apply, so contact me for pricing.

Q: Do you do group buys? My friends and I want to save some money.
A: I do group buys. Have a representative from your group contact me for details.

Travis,

If your kits include the lubricant, like said motor oil, make sure you check that your shipments doesn't fall under dangerous goods or hazardous materials? There are certain items that cannot be shipped with the USPS. FedEx & UPS will, but it must be declared, and you have to be qualified to ship these type of goods. A lot of common products like perfume, spray cans, anything with reminants of fuel is a no no through the mail.

Really not sure if motor oil is considered hazardous. Since you are not the original manufacturer of the oil, you can't ship under ORMD, which allows the manufucturer to ship without Hazmat documents.
